Had a quick look at the CAA stats and many significant routes are down. UK domestic with the exception of Inverness and Isle of Man is all minus. Routes like Alicante, Faro, Tenerife, Berlin are all minus. Amsterdam is down 20%. It'll be interesting to see if the down continues for July or if this is just a blip.
 
The number of passengers in June 2025 was down - second month in a row - cannot think of any reason why - any ideas ?
I can only speak from the POV of my local airport (GLA), we were down around 5k, but all of that was a decline in the German market caused by the Euros being on last year.
